SHW Complete Factory Conversion

SHW’s Building Consultancy Department were instructed to complete a conversion of a former factory at Wellington Road, Portslade into a new self-storage facility.

Storagemart In Portslade conversion from Factory

The external work included a full roof replacement, cladding of the exterior walls, installation of a new CCTV security system and access panels, and new car parking including electric gates. Internally a lot of work was completed including new doors and windows throughout, creation of an office, reception, staff facilities and kitchen, new plumbing and electrics, a new lift servicing the three floors and the fit out of the self-service storage units. The works were specified to achieve a BREEAM ‘Very Good’ rating.

 

The budget for this extensive project was £3.1 million and the team are pleased to announce the project came in on budget and within the 13-month timeframe with an allotted one-month extension work agreed.

 

Daniel Saunders, Senior VP at StorageMart commented "When we were first introduced to the site it was difficult to see past the sheer scale of contamination across the entire building so every surface required correct remediation. 

SHW in tandem with the principal contractor brought great insights and novel approaches to deliver on our expectations and budget despite the myriad challenges the site presented"

 

Paul Armstrong, SHW Building Surveyor comments “This was a fantastic project to work on, with a constructive collaborative approach between us, the client and the contractor. At the start of the project the building was in a poor state of repair and posed several challenges along the way, but with a lot of hard work the finished result is an impressive unit completed to a high standard throughout.”
